MIDSUMMER :: 7FLOWERS :: 1DREAM

This weekend we celebrate Midsummer. It´s always one of the biggest -if not the biggest- festivity in Sweden. As cities turn into ghost towns, everybody goes to the countryside, to spend this weekend with family & friends. According to tradition, maidens should pick seven flowers during the midsummer night and put the flowers underneath their pillow. In return the midsummer night will bring them dreams about the man they´re going to marry. With that being a fun tradition, I just had to do that too! Even if this was actually supposed to be done by maidens and with wild flowers; these are modern times, so I added some personal touches to it! Virtual City :: Sang Un Jeon

"We are living in a world that is connected with real interaction with real people, but we spend ever more increasing amount of time on the internet, creating this virtual world that deals with pretty much everything we do in real life. We constantly engage and interact with each other through this virtual space, and the current technology have gotten to the point where we can virtually navigate real life street and see what´s out there without bothering to go out and actually see. Virtual City is a visualization of the current topography of this virtual world called the World Wide Web. Using Google Sketch-up Pro, Rhinoceros and 3d printing, virtualized real-life buildings were re-realized, combined with the initials of the most well established communities on the Internet.
